Silence the Shame is a nonprofit organization that focuses on education and awareness around mental health. Our programs and initiatives consist of Crisis Response Trainings, Community Conversations, Wellness Trainings, digital content, and outreach events. We aim to normalize the conversation, peel back the layers of shame, eliminate stigma, and provide support for mental well-being.
Established as The Hip-Hop Professional Foundation, the organization gained momentum quickly when Silence the Shame was launched as an anti-stigma mental health awareness campaign. STS Founder Shanti Das partnered with influencers and celebrities through social media to bring awareness to mental health and the impact of stigma. With this momentum, the organization moved to change the Hip-Hop Professional Foundation's name to Silence the Shame, Inc. to maintain branding.

Silence the Shame Community Conversations are curated panel discussions that create a safe environment to discuss mental health. Founder Shanti Das typically moderates the discussion and we include licensed mental health professionals and those with lived experiences. As a result of this global pandemic, Silence the Shame has been hosting free webinars on Zoom to provide healthy ways to cope during the quarantine.

Self-Care Saturdays are virtual and face to face sessions to engage people in wellness activities to reduce feelings of stress, manage mental illnesses and promote social connectedness. For each event, we partner with various zumba, yoga and other fitness instructors to provide engaging content for the community to practice mental wellness strategies at home and access behavioral health resources.
